A public hearing was conducted on April 14th , 1982 at
2 : 00 P.M. , with the following present:
JOHN MARTIN CHAIRMAN
CHUCK CARLSON PRO TEM, Excused
NORMAN CARLSON COMMISSIONER, Excused
BILL KIRBY COMMISSIONER
JUNE STEINMARK COMMISSIONER
Also present:
ACTING CLERK TO THE BOARD, Jeannette Ordway
ASSISTANT COUNTY ATTORNEY, R. Russell Anson
PLANNING DEPARTMENT REPRESENTATIVE, Rod Allison
The following business was transacted:
I hereby certify that pursuant to a notice dated February 22, 1982,
duly published March 25, 1982 in the Johnstown Breeze, a public hearing was
held on the request of Chase E. Rinehart for a Use By Special Review for an
agri business farm sprinklers installation and service. Glenn Billings, was
present representing the applicant and Mr. Chase E. Rinehart was also present.
Mr. Billings stated that they do not have any objections to the Planning
Commission recommendations. He added that they do plan to use the existing
foundations. Mr. Billings added that before the second structure is constructed
they will request a variance from the set back requirements. He commented on
the plans of this site. The traffic flow should not increase because even during
their heaviest season there will only be five to six employees going to and from
the site. There were no objections to this request. The Planning Commission
recommended that this request be approved with conditions and standards.
After review, Commissioner Kirby made a motion to approve this request including
the Planning Commissions conditions and standards. Commissioner Steinmark seconded
the motion and it carried unanimously.
